No. A Mac with a Power PC processor like your G4 Mac can only boot from am internal HD or optical drive or to an external device connected via FireWire. The old Macs do not support booting via a USB connected device.


A power PC Mac can't run OSX higher than 10.5.8.

You can call Apple and order 10.5.8 or order original install disks. You do need to supply the serial number.
